Dark areas on the surface of the sun are called sunspots. They appear darker because they are cooler areas compared to their surroundings due to strong magnetic activity. Sunspots are temporary phenomena that can last from days to weeks.
On the surface of the Sun, or its photosphere, you can find sunspots and granules. Sunspots are cooler, darker areas caused by magnetic activity, while granules are small, bright features resulting from convection currents in the Sun's plasma. Both phenomena contribute to the dynamic and ever-changing appearance of the Sun's surface.
The layer of the Sun that is considered its surface is the photosphere. It is the visible layer from which sunlight is emitted and has a temperature of about 5,500 degrees Celsius (9,932 degrees Fahrenheit). The photosphere is where sunspots and solar phenomena occur, and it appears as a bright, glowing surface when viewed from Earth.
Blemishes on the sun are called sunspots. They appear as dark spots on the sun's surface and are caused by variations in its magnetic field. Sunspots are temporary phenomena that can affect space weather and solar activity.
The bright red layer on the surface of the sun is known as the chromosphere. It is composed mainly of hydrogen gas and emits light at various wavelengths, giving it a reddish hue. The chromosphere is located above the sun's visible surface, the photosphere, and is significant in solar dynamics and phenomena.

The five surface features of the sun are sunspots, solar flares, prominences, faculae, and granulation. These features are caused by the dynamic processes occurring on the sun's surface due to its magnetic field and internal convective motion.
